Define a default server:
By specifying a default server IP address, all incoming connections that don't
match a specifically configured static NAPT entry will be forwarded to the
device with this IP address. This setting should be adequate for most server
applications and eliminates the need for specific static NAPT entries.
Configure UPnP
The three UPnP configurations are:
Full
The SpeedTouch™ is UPnP enabled, all local hosts are able to detect the
SpeedTouch™. Any local host is able to create port mappings for any
local device.
Secure
The SpeedTouch™ is UPnP enabled, all local hosts are able to detect the
SpeedTouch™. A local host is allowed to make port mappings for its
own, i.e. a local host is not allowed to create port mappings for other
local devices.
Off
The SpeedTouch™ is UPnP disabled, none of the local hosts is able to
detect the SpeedTouch™. Via UPnP no port mappings can be created.
